Improving Stress Management and Self-Care Practices for Software Engineers with Mindfulness Techniques

Summary

  • Software engineers face high levels of stress in their everyday work routine.
  • Mindfulness techniques can help improve Stress management and self-care practices for software engineers.
  • Implementing Mindfulness practices can lead to increased Focus, productivity, and overall Well-being.

Introduction

Software engineering is a demanding and high-pressure profession that often leads to stress and Burnout. The fast-paced nature of the industry, tight deadlines, and challenging problem-solving can take a toll on one's mental and physical Well-being. In order to combat the negative effects of stress and maintain a healthy work-life balance, it is important for software engineers to incorporate Mindfulness techniques into their everyday work routine.

The Benefits of Mindfulness for Software Engineers

Implementing Mindfulness techniques can have a variety of benefits for software engineers, including:

  1. Reduced stress levels
  2. Increased Focus and concentration
  3. Improved emotional regulation
  4. Enhanced problem-solving skills
  5. Better communication and collaboration with team members

Specific Mindfulness Techniques for Software Engineers

1. Mindful Breathing

One of the simplest and most effective Mindfulness techniques is mindful breathing. Taking a few moments throughout the day to Focus on your breath can help calm the mind, reduce stress, and increase Focus. Software engineers can incorporate mindful breathing into their work routine by:

  1. Taking deep breaths before starting a new task
  2. Pausing for a minute to Focus on breathing during stressful situations
  3. Setting a reminder to take deep breaths every hour
  4. Using Breathing exercises to re-energize and refocus during long work sessions

2. Mindful Movement

Engaging in mindful movement practices, such as Yoga or Stretching, can help software engineers release tension, improve posture, and increase overall Well-being. Incorporating mindful movement into the work routine can be done by:

  1. Setting aside time for a quick Yoga session or Stretching break during the workday
  2. Using a standing desk or ergonomic chair to promote better posture
  3. Practicing Mindfulness while walking to meetings or around the office

3. Mindful Tech Usage

Software engineers spend a significant amount of time working on computers and mobile devices, which can lead to eye strain, poor posture, and mental fatigue. Practicing mindful tech usage can help reduce the negative effects of screen time and improve overall Well-being. Software engineers can implement mindful tech usage by:

  1. Taking regular breaks from screens to rest the eyes and stretch the body
  2. Setting boundaries for tech usage outside of work hours
  3. Using Mindfulness apps or tools to track screen time and remind of breaks

Conclusion

Incorporating Mindfulness techniques into the everyday work routine can greatly improve Stress management and self-care practices for software engineers. By implementing mindful breathing, movement, and tech usage, software engineers can reduce stress levels, increase Focus, and enhance overall Well-being. Taking care of mental and physical health is essential in a high-pressure profession like software engineering, and Mindfulness techniques can be a powerful tool in achieving a healthy work-life balance.

chillin-rocks-illustration

Disclaimer: The content provided on this blog is for informational purposes only, reflecting the personal opinions and insights of the author(s) on the topics. The information provided should not be used for diagnosing or treating a health problem or disease, and those seeking personal medical advice should consult with a licensed physician. Always seek the advice of your doctor or other qualified health provider regarding a medical condition. Never disregard professional medical advice or delay in seeking it because of something you have read on this website. If you think you may have a medical emergency, call 911 or go to the nearest emergency room immediately. No physician-patient relationship is created by this web site or its use. No contributors to this web site make any representations, express or implied, with respect to the information provided herein or to its use. While we strive to share accurate and up-to-date information, we cannot guarantee the completeness, reliability, or accuracy of the content. The blog may also include links to external websites and resources for the convenience of our readers. Please note that linking to other sites does not imply endorsement of their content, practices, or services by us. Readers should use their discretion and judgment while exploring any external links and resources mentioned on this blog. Content in this blog is copyright protected, please do not repost or embed content without prior written permission.

Related Videos

Previous
Previous

Benefits of Using Stress Balls to Improve Focus and Reduce Stress and Anxiety in Daily Life

Next
Next

The Importance of Regular Breaks and Micro-Naps: Enhancing Focus and Reducing Anxiety